    And for those of you who just “assume” they were racing or driving recklessly, shame on you. The Ferrari was at a complete stop and so was the GT-R, waiting for traffic to get moving. The third vehicle, a white commercial van, barreled into both cars at 50 mph. So yes, there was reckless driving, but not by either sports car.
